An Authentic Encounter with Elephants
The core of this tour is a visit to the Kuala Gandah Elephant Sanctuary, renowned for its conservation efforts. As a private tour, it offers a more detailed and intimate experience—you’ll get much closer to the elephants than on standard group trips, but importantly, no contact with the animals takes place.
Many reviewers have appreciated the knowledgeable guides and friendly drivers, with some paying for an educational guide upgrade. One traveler noted, “We learnt how to feed the elephants and bought bananas for just 5 MYR.” This hands-on aspect, albeit without direct contact, adds a layer of engagement that many wildlife enthusiasts find rewarding. The sanctuary’s focus on wild elephants provides a natural environment, making it a strong alternative to zoos or captivity.
The drive from Kuala Lumpur takes approximately an hour and a half, which allows you to relax and enjoy the countryside views. One reviewer praised the journey, calling the driver “fun, skilled, and very friendly,” which set a lively tone for the day. The six-hour duration ensures enough time to explore without feeling hurried.

Batu Caves: A Cultural Marvel
After the sanctuary, the tour makes a 30-minute stop at Batu Caves, an iconic landmark just north of Kuala Lumpur. This limestone hill features three main caves with Hindu temples and shrines, making it a popular spot for both worshippers and travelers.
The large statue of the Hindu god Murugan at the entrance and the 272 steep steps leading up to the main cave** are unforgettable sights. Visitors often comment on the monkeys that frolic around—some even mention having to watch their belongings! The site offers stunning views of Kuala Lumpur’s skyline, providing excellent photo opportunities.
Reviewer comments include, “Batu Caves is an iconic and popular attraction—definitely worth the quick stop,” and “You can buy bananas from a stall for just 5 MYR to feed the monkeys.” It’s a lively, vibrant stop that balances the sacred with the lively chatter of travelers and locals alike.
